Proposed development

Application description published by Monaghan County Council.
Retention & permission for the following development: 1) To retain change of use from a single storey agricultural shed to a two-storey style dwelling house with carport and garage on ground floor level, with increased ridge height, Elevational changes and retain entrance gate pillars with wing walls and concrete apron at roadside, and 2) Permission to complete the development and proposed new sewerage wastewater treatment system and percolation area and all ancillary site works
